Bug Description

Testing Precise localized ISO with usb live disk 20120317

1) create a live usb session persistent;
2) boot it
3) click on an indicator on the top panel to open its menu.
4) click on the print screen key (Stamp on some systems) to take a screenshot of the Desktop.

It should take a screenshot launching gnome-screenshot app, but in fact nothing happen.
If no menu is open it does.
